Arris SBG6782AC Dual-Band Cable Modem: High-Speed Performance Meets Seamless Functionality
All-in-One Solution
The Arris SBG6782AC Dual-Band Cable Modem is not just a modem, but a comprehensive solution for your home network needs. This three-in-one powerhouse functions as a DOCSIS 3.0 cable modem, a dual-band concurrent 802.11ac Wi-Fi access point, and a 4-port Gigabit Ethernet router. Say goodbye to a multitude of devices and experience a streamlined internet setup with the SBG6782AC.
Unmatched Speed and Reliability
Designed for high-speed internet enthusiasts, the Arris SBG6782AC offers impressive download speeds of up to 343 Mbps and Wi-Fi speeds up to 1600 Mbps. Whether you’re streaming your favorite shows in 4K, gaming online, or participating in video conferences, you can count on a reliable and lightning-fast connection.
Seamless Compatibility
A key feature of the Arris SBG6782AC is its extensive compatibility. Compatible with major internet service providers, including Spectrum, Time Warner, Cox, and Comcast Xfinity, this modem provides the flexibility of use across a wide variety of service providers, ensuring seamless usage, even if you switch your ISP.
Advanced Networking Features
The SBG6782AC goes beyond just providing fast internet. It includes dual-band capability, allowing you to switch between frequencies for optimized Wi-Fi performance. The device also supports IPv4 and IPv6 for future-proof networking. Its 8×4 channel bonding enhances the DOCSIS 3.0 speeds and reliability, ensuring you experience smooth, uninterrupted internet connectivity.
Robust Wired Connectivity
With its built-in 4-port Gigabit Ethernet router, the SBG6782AC ensures you can connect multiple wired devices for high-speed, stable connections. Ideal for devices that require a wired connection, this feature adds another layer of versatility to this multifaceted modem.

Will this work with my internet company?
This Arris modem is primarily used and is compatible with Comcast, Cox, Spectrum, Charter, & Time Warner service in most areas. To verify that this model will work in your area, always contact your service provider’s customer service prior to placing your order with us to confirm that this model will work with your service plan. Some service plan speeds may not be supported.
Arris SBG6782AC Dual-Band Cable Modem FAQ
Q1: Is the Arris SBG6782AC compatible with my internet service provider?
A1: The Arris SBG6782AC modem is compatible with several major internet service providers in the US, including Spectrum, Time Warner, Cox, and Comcast Xfinity. However, it is recommended to confirm with your service provider before purchase.
Q2: What are the maximum speeds supported by the Arris SBG6782AC?
A2: The Arris SBG6782AC supports impressive download speeds up to 343 Mbps and Wi-Fi speeds up to 1600 Mbps, making it suitable for high-demand internet activities like online gaming and 4K video streaming.
Q3: Does the Arris SBG6782AC support both 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z Wi-Fi bands?
A3: Yes, the Arris SBG6782AC supports dual-band concurrent 802.11ac Wi-Fi, meaning it can operate on both 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z frequencies simultaneously for optimal Wi-Fi performance.
Q4: Does the Arris SBG6782AC support IPv6?
A4: Yes, the Arris SBG6782AC supports both IPv4 and IPv6. This ensures your home network is future-proofed and ready to adapt to evolving internet protocols.
Q5: How many devices can I connect to the Arris SBG6782AC using Ethernet cables?
A5: The Arris SBG6782AC includes a 4-port Gigabit Ethernet router, allowing you to connect up to four devices via Ethernet cables for a stable, high-speed connection.
Q6: Can I use the Arris SBG6782AC as a standalone Wi-Fi router?
A6: The Arris SBG6782AC is a 3-in-1 device combining a DOCSIS 3.0 cable modem, dual-band concurrent 802.11ac Wi-Fi access point, and a 4-port Gigabit Ethernet router. This means you can use it as a standalone Wi-Fi router if you already have a separate modem.

Over 25,000 reviews! So just my quick 2 cents(I am reviewing specifically the SBG6782-AC AC1750 Modem/Wi-Fi Router):*First and foremost, remember – this is a router and modem in one, so for most cable internet users, you have to call to your service provider and tell them the MAC address of this product, so they can enter it into your account, before it can work properly. This is something you have to do each time you replace the modem, not the router. I had forgotten about that fact, and although the diagnostics showed it was sending and receiving data, I couldn’t get an Internet connection. Gave Time Warner Cable a call, and it was working immediately after. You can find the MAC address on the product box, inside the instruction booklet, and/or on the modem itself.*Once up and running, it’s been working flawlessly. I have the 100 Mbps down/10 Mbps up package, and Speedtest.net confirms it for both Wi-Fi and Ethernet connections(actually 118 Mbps down/12 Mbps up).*The IP/Web address to set up the configurations is 192.168.0.1 – the default username and password is admin/motorola.*The dimensions are quite big, at just over 10 inches long, just under 9 inches tall, and 3.25 inches wide at the base/stand, and just under 2.25 inches for the box’s actual width. It weighs about two pounds.
